Struggling to Make the Grade : A Review of the Causes and Consequences of the Weak Outcomes of South Africa's Education System /
While South Africa has made significant improvements in basic and tertiary education enrollment, the country still suffers from significant challenges in the quality of educational achievement by almost any international metric.
